Ross Castle
Step back in time at Ross Castle, a 15th-century tower house perched on the edge of Lough Leane in Killarney National Park. Once a stronghold of the O'Donoghue clan, this imposing fortress offers a glimpse into medieval Irish life. Explore its sturdy stone walls, learn about its sieges and legends, and soak in the panoramic views of the surrounding lake and mountains. Guided tours offer deeper insights into the castle's history, making it an essential stop for history enthusiasts and nature lovers alike.

Ladies View
Prepare to be mesmerized at Ladies View, a breathtaking panoramic vista along the Ring of Kerry. Named in honor of Queen Victoria's ladies-in-waiting, who admired the view during a visit in 1861, this iconic viewpoint offers sweeping views of the three lakes of Killarney and the sprawling National Park, all framed by Ireland's majestic mountain range. Capture the beauty of this unforgettable landscape and create memories that will last a lifetime.
